About the role
Key responsibilities & impact- Enable patients to remain in their homes by providing health and personal services
- Assess and record patient conditions by monitoring vital signs
- Administer treatments, including dispensing medications, changing bandages, and administering oxygen supply and equipment
- Teach patients and family members assisted living techniques, including use of mobility aids and special utensils
- Teach personal hygiene techniques and appropriate methods for lifting, turning, and repositioning patients
- Interpret varied work assignments and independently determine appropriate courses of action
- Follow established guidelines and procedures while working with minimal direction
- Support Humana's patient-focused, post-acute care model through home health services
